在数据挖掘中,复杂类型的数据挖掘主要包括文本挖掘、图像挖掘、视频挖掘、音频挖掘、网络挖掘、时序数据挖掘。文本挖掘是其中最常见的一种,它通过自然语言处理(NLP)技术来分析和理解文本数据,从而发现隐藏的模式和信息。文本挖掘可以用于情感分析、主题建模、自动摘要生成等应用领域。随着社交媒体和互联网的普及,文本数据的量级急剧增加,文本挖掘的技术也在不断进步,以应对这些海量数据的处理和分析需求。
一、文本挖掘
文本挖掘是一种通过自然语言处理(NLP)技术来分析和理解文本数据的方法。文本挖掘的核心技术包括分词、词性标注、命名实体识别、情感分析、主题建模。分词是将文本切分成一个个词语的过程,是文本挖掘的基础步骤。词性标注则是在分词的基础上,给每个词语标注它的词性。命名实体识别是识别出文本中的特定实体,如人名、地名、组织名等。情感分析是通过分析文本来判断其表达的情感倾向,如正面、负面或中性。主题建模是一种自动化技术,用于从大量文本中提取出主要的主题或话题。
二、图像挖掘
图像挖掘是从图像数据中提取有用信息和模式的过程。图像挖掘的核心技术包括图像预处理、特征提取、图像分类、对象检测、图像分割。图像预处理是对原始图像进行处理,如去噪、增强对比度等,以提高图像质量。特征提取是从图像中提取出能够代表图像内容的特征,如边缘、纹理、颜色等。图像分类是将图像分为不同类别,如动物、植物、建筑等。对象检测是识别出图像中的特定对象,并标注其位置。图像分割是将图像分割成若干个区域,每个区域代表一个对象或背景。
三、视频挖掘
视频挖掘是从视频数据中提取有用信息和模式的过程。视频挖掘的核心技术包括视频预处理、关键帧提取、动作识别、视频摘要生成、视频检索。视频预处理是对原始视频进行处理,如去噪、增强对比度等,以提高视频质量。关键帧提取是从视频中提取出能够代表视频内容的关键帧,这些关键帧可以用于后续的分析和处理。动作识别是通过分析视频帧中的动作,识别出特定的动作,如跑步、跳跃等。视频摘要生成是通过提取视频的关键帧和动作,生成一个简短的视频摘要。视频检索是通过输入一个查询条件,从大量视频中检索出符合条件的视频。
四、音频挖掘
音频挖掘是从音频数据中提取有用信息和模式的过程。音频挖掘的核心技术包括音频预处理、特征提取、音频分类、语音识别、情感识别。音频预处理是对原始音频进行处理,如去噪、增强音量等,以提高音频质量。特征提取是从音频中提取出能够代表音频内容的特征,如频谱、音调、节奏等。音频分类是将音频分为不同类别,如音乐、语音、环境声音等。语音识别是将音频中的语音转换为文本。情感识别是通过分析音频中的语音,识别出说话者的情感,如高兴、悲伤、愤怒等。
五、网络挖掘
网络挖掘是从网络数据中提取有用信息和模式的过程。网络挖掘的核心技术包括链接分析、社交网络分析、网络爬虫、网络内容挖掘、网络结构挖掘。链接分析是通过分析网络中的链接关系,发现重要的节点和链接,如PageRank算法。社交网络分析是通过分析社交网络中的用户和关系,发现社交网络中的社区结构和影响力用户。网络爬虫是通过自动化程序,从网络中抓取数据。网络内容挖掘是从网络页面中提取出有用的信息,如文本、图像、视频等。网络结构挖掘是分析网络的拓扑结构,发现网络中的模式和规律。
六、时序数据挖掘
时序数据挖掘是从时序数据中提取有用信息和模式的过程。时序数据挖掘的核心技术包括时序模式发现、时序预测、时序分类、时序聚类、时序异常检测。时序模式发现是从时序数据中发现重复出现的模式,如季节性变化、周期性波动等。时序预测是通过分析时序数据,预测未来的变化趋势,如股票价格预测、天气预测等。时序分类是将时序数据分为不同类别,如正常、异常等。时序聚类是将相似的时序数据聚集在一起,如相似的用户行为、相似的设备故障等。时序异常检测是通过分析时序数据,发现异常的变化,如设备故障、网络攻击等。
七、复杂类型数据挖掘的应用领域
复杂类型的数据挖掘在各个领域都有广泛的应用。在医疗领域,复杂类型的数据挖掘可以用于疾病预测、患者分类、医疗影像分析。在金融领域,复杂类型的数据挖掘可以用于风险评估、欺诈检测、客户行为分析。在零售领域,复杂类型的数据挖掘可以用于市场分析、客户细分、推荐系统。在制造领域,复杂类型的数据挖掘可以用于设备故障预测、生产优化、质量控制。在交通领域,复杂类型的数据挖掘可以用于交通流量预测、交通事故分析、交通信号优化。
八、复杂类型数据挖掘的挑战
复杂类型的数据挖掘面临许多挑战。数据的高维性、数据的异构性、数据的噪声、数据的动态变化、数据的隐私保护。数据的高维性是指数据的维度很多,如图像数据的每个像素都可以看作一个维度。数据的异构性是指数据的类型很多,如文本、图像、视频、音频等。数据的噪声是指数据中存在很多无用的信息,如网络中的垃圾信息。数据的动态变化是指数据不断变化,如社交网络中的用户关系。数据的隐私保护是指在数据挖掘过程中,如何保护用户的隐私。
九、复杂类型数据挖掘的发展趋势
复杂类型的数据挖掘正在不断发展和进步。深度学习、强化学习、联邦学习、边缘计算、量子计算。深度学习是一种基于神经网络的机器学习方法,可以用于处理高维、异构的数据。强化学习是一种通过与环境交互来学习策略的方法,可以用于处理动态变化的数据。联邦学习是一种分布式的机器学习方法,可以在保护数据隐私的前提下,进行数据挖掘。边缘计算是一种在数据源附近进行计算的方法,可以减少数据传输的延迟。量子计算是一种基于量子力学原理的计算方法,可以提高数据挖掘的效率。
十、复杂类型数据挖掘的未来展望
复杂类型的数据挖掘将在未来发挥越来越重要的作用。数据挖掘技术的进步、数据量的增加、计算能力的提高、应用场景的扩展、跨学科的融合。数据挖掘技术的进步将使得我们能够处理更加复杂的数据,发现更加深层次的模式。数据量的增加将提供更多的数据来源,使得数据挖掘的结果更加准确。计算能力的提高将使得我们能够处理更加大规模的数据,提高数据挖掘的效率。应用场景的扩展将使得数据挖掘在更多的领域得到应用,发挥更大的价值。跨学科的融合将使得数据挖掘与其他学科结合,产生更多的创新和突破。
相关问答FAQs:
复杂类型的数据挖掘有哪些?
复杂类型的数据挖掘是指在处理多样化的数据源和类型时所采用的一系列技术和方法。与传统的数据挖掘方法相比,复杂数据挖掘更强调对非结构化或半结构化数据的分析,如文本、图像、视频和社交网络数据等。以下是一些复杂类型的数据挖掘技术及其应用场景。
-
文本挖掘
文本挖掘是从大量文本数据中提取有用信息的过程。这一过程通常涉及自然语言处理(NLP)技术,旨在理解和分析人类语言。应用场景包括情感分析、主题建模和信息提取等。在情感分析中,企业可以分析社交媒体上的用户评论,以了解客户对产品的看法,从而优化市场策略。 -
图像挖掘
图像挖掘涉及从图像数据中提取有价值的信息,通常结合计算机视觉技术。应用包括医学影像分析、自动标签生成和图像分类等。在医学领域,通过分析X光片或MRI图像,医生可以更早地发现疾病并进行诊断,提升医疗效率和准确性。 -
社交网络分析
社交网络分析旨在研究社交网络中个体之间的关系和互动模式。通过分析用户的社交行为,企业可以识别影响力用户,优化广告投放策略。在公共安全领域,警方可以利用社交网络分析追踪犯罪活动,识别犯罪团伙。 -
时间序列分析
时间序列分析是对随时间变化的数据进行分析的一种方法。它广泛应用于金融市场预测、气象数据分析和库存管理等领域。通过识别数据中的趋势和周期模式,企业能够做出更科学的决策。 -
生物信息学数据挖掘
这一领域结合了生物学和计算机科学,旨在从基因组数据、蛋白质结构数据等中提取有用信息。应用包括基因组测序分析、新药研发等。通过深入分析基因组数据,研究人员能够识别与特定疾病相关的基因变异,从而推动精准医疗的发展。 -
图挖掘
图挖掘技术用于分析图结构数据,例如社交网络、道路网络和生物网络。通过分析节点和边的关系,研究人员可以识别网络中的关键节点、社区结构等。在交通管理中,图挖掘可以帮助优化路线规划,提高运输效率。 -
多媒体数据挖掘
多媒体数据挖掘涉及音频、视频和图像等多种形式的数据分析。应用场景包括视频监控分析、音乐推荐系统等。通过分析用户的观看历史和偏好,流媒体平台可以提供个性化的内容推荐,从而提升用户体验。 -
IoT数据挖掘
物联网(IoT)数据挖掘是从各种传感器和设备收集的数据中提取有用信息。应用包括智能家居、智能交通管理和工业自动化等。通过分析IoT设备生成的数据,企业能够优化操作流程,降低成本,提升效率。 -
异构数据挖掘
异构数据挖掘技术用于处理来自不同来源和不同类型的数据,如结构化数据、非结构化数据和半结构化数据。应用场景包括金融欺诈检测、客户行为分析等。通过整合多种数据源,企业可以获得更全面的用户画像,从而提升决策的准确性。 -
深度学习在数据挖掘中的应用
深度学习是一种基于神经网络的学习方法,广泛应用于图像识别、自然语言处理和推荐系统等领域。通过训练深层网络模型,能够自动提取数据中的特征,提高数据挖掘的精度和效率。
复杂类型的数据挖掘涵盖了多种技术和方法,随着数据量的增加和计算能力的提升,其应用场景愈加广泛。企业和研究机构通过有效的数据挖掘技术,能够从复杂数据中提取有价值的信息,推动业务发展和科学研究的进步。
数据挖掘的挑战与未来发展方向是什么?
数据挖掘在为企业和研究提供价值的同时,也面临着一系列挑战。理解这些挑战对于选择合适的技术和方法至关重要。
-
数据隐私与安全性
在数据挖掘过程中,用户的隐私和数据安全问题越来越受到关注。如何在保证用户隐私的前提下进行数据分析成为一项重要挑战。企业需要遵循相关法律法规,并采用数据加密、匿名化等技术,以保护用户的敏感信息。 -
数据质量问题
数据的准确性和完整性直接影响挖掘结果的可靠性。许多企业在进行数据挖掘时,往往面临数据不一致、缺失或噪声等问题。因此,提高数据质量是数据挖掘成功的关键。 -
算法复杂性
随着数据规模的不断扩大,数据挖掘算法的复杂性和计算需求也随之增加。如何设计高效的算法,以处理大规模数据集,是研究人员面临的一大挑战。 -
实时数据处理
在金融、交通等领域,实时数据分析需求日益增长。如何快速处理和分析流式数据,以获得及时的决策支持,成为数据挖掘领域的一个重要研究方向。 -
跨域数据整合
在许多应用场景中,数据来自不同的领域和来源。如何有效整合和分析跨域数据,提取有用信息,是当前数据挖掘研究的热点之一。
未来,随着人工智能、机器学习等技术的不断进步,数据挖掘将朝着更高效、更智能的方向发展。以下是一些可能的发展趋势:
-
自动化数据挖掘
借助自动化工具和技术,数据挖掘的过程将变得更加简便。企业能够通过自动化的数据分析平台,快速获取有价值的信息,而无需深入了解复杂的算法。 -
集成学习与增强学习
集成学习和增强学习将在数据挖掘中发挥越来越重要的作用。这些方法能够通过组合多个模型的预测结果,提高分析的准确性和鲁棒性。 -
边缘计算与数据挖掘结合
随着物联网的普及,边缘计算将与数据挖掘相结合,实现更快速的数据分析和决策。通过在数据源附近进行处理,能够减少延迟,提高实时响应能力。 -
多模态数据挖掘
未来的数据挖掘将更加关注多模态数据的整合与分析。通过结合不同类型的数据源,例如文本、图像和传感器数据,研究人员能够获得更全面的洞察。 -
可解释性与透明性
随着人们对算法透明性和可解释性的关注增加,数据挖掘模型的可解释性将成为研究的重要方向。企业需要能够向用户清晰地解释数据分析的过程和结果,以增强信任。
复杂类型的数据挖掘在不断演化,挑战与机遇并存。通过不断创新和改进,数据挖掘技术将继续为各行各业提供强大的支持,推动社会的发展与进步。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。